What are all kinds of booby birds?

Booby birds refer to the six species of seabirds in the genus Sula. These include the blue-footed booby, red-footed booby, Nazca booby, brown booby, Peruvian booby, and masked booby. They are known for their distinct coloring and often clumsy, awkward movements on land.

Where do Blue-footed Booby live?

Blue-footed Boobies primarily live on the Pacific coast of Central and South America, including the Galapagos Islands. They can also be found in smaller numbers along the coast of the Gulf of California.
